Description

Datonychus is a genus of weevils belonging to the Curculionidae family within the Coleoptera order. These insects are recognized as specialized pests that primarily target plants from the Brassicaceae family. In agricultural environments, they act as significant plant parasites that can cause substantial economic losses if left unmonitored.

The host range of Datonychus includes various vegetable and oilseed crops such as cabbage, radish, turnip, rapeseed, and mustard. Both adults and larvae contribute to the damage, although their methods of feeding differ significantly, affecting various structural parts of the host plants.

The biology of Datonychus involves a life cycle typically consisting of egg, larva, pupa, and adult stages. Adult weevils overwinter in soil debris or under crop residues. Once temperatures rise in the spring, they emerge to feed on host foliage and initiate the reproductive cycle, laying eggs within the plant tissue to ensure the larvae have immediate access to food upon hatching.

The damage caused by Datonychus is twofold. Adults create characteristic shot-hole patterns on leaves, which reduce photosynthetic capacity. Larvae, conversely, act as miners, creating galleries within leaf petioles and stems. This internal feeding can stunt plant growth, weaken structural integrity, and make the crops susceptible to secondary infections.

Effective management strategies rely heavily on an integrated pest management (IPM) approach. Key practices include crop rotation to break the pest cycle, deep plowing after harvest to bury overwintering adults, and the removal of wild cruciferous weeds from field margins. Chemical control with appropriate insecticides may be necessary during peak infestation periods, ensuring that application timing aligns with the vulnerable stages of the insect's development.
